What is the Ghost Robot Dog?

The Ghost Robot Dog is a high-tech, quadruped robot that is designed for both commercial and military applications. It’s part of a growing category of robotic dogs that can navigate challenging terrains, perform complex tasks, and carry loads in environments that may be too dangerous or difficult for humans to access. Ghost Robotics, the company behind this robot, has developed it with a focus on versatility, making it suitable for various industries, including security, logistics, and defense.

How Much Does the Ghost Robot Dog Cost?

The price of the Ghost Robot Dog varies based on the configuration and features you choose. While exact figures may fluctuate depending on customization and specific deals, the cost typically ranges from $50,000 to $75,000.

This price includes the base model of the robot with standard capabilities, such as mobility on rough terrains, video and sensor systems, and the ability to carry lightweight loads. Customizations like additional sensors, higher payload capacity, or advanced surveillance equipment could increase the price even further.

For comparison, other robotic dogs in the same class, like Boston Dynamics’ Spot, can also cost in the same price range, often with more specialized functionalities depending on the application.

Features of the Ghost Robot Dog

While its price might seem steep, the Ghost Robot Dog offers a variety of features that make it an attractive option for industries that require advanced robotics. Some of the key features include:

  1. Rugged Mobility:

    • The Ghost robot is built to handle tough terrain, making it ideal for outdoor exploration, reconnaissance missions, and rescue operations. It can easily traverse rugged environments, stairs, and even navigate obstacles like rubble or uneven surfaces.
  2. Versatile Applications:

    • It can be used in various fields, including security, logistics, defense, and surveillance. For example, the Ghost robot can be deployed for security patrols, carrying equipment, or providing real-time video feeds for military personnel.
  3. Customizability:

    • The robot can be customized with different payloads, sensors, and cameras, depending on the specific needs of the user. For instance, you can equip it with thermal cameras, high-definition video cameras, or even LIDAR sensors for mapping.
  4. Durability:

    • Designed to withstand harsh conditions, the Ghost robot is durable, capable of working in extreme weather conditions, and can even operate in areas that are hazardous to human health, such as toxic environments or disaster zones.
  5. Autonomy:

    • With advanced AI and machine learning capabilities, the Ghost Robot Dog can navigate autonomously and perform tasks without constant human supervision. It can follow programmed paths, avoid obstacles, and respond to changes in its environment.
  6. Heavy Duty Performance:

    • Some models come with the ability to carry moderate loads, like medical supplies, security equipment, or communication devices, making them valuable for use in emergency situations or military operations.

Who Uses the Ghost Robot Dog?

Due to its high price point and sophisticated features, the Ghost Robot Dog is primarily used by:

  • Military and Defense: For reconnaissance, surveillance, and bomb detection.
  • Security and Law Enforcement: As a mobile patrol unit or for surveillance in high-risk areas.
  • Rescue and Emergency Services: In search-and-rescue operations or to access dangerous environments.
  • Research and Exploration: For scientific missions, environmental monitoring, or industrial inspections.
